'NDA govt likely to name Governors for seven states tomorrow'

The central government is likely to announce soon the names of governors to be appointed in seven states, as per news reports on Saturday. 

The new appointments by the NDA government are set to take place after the governors of the states were reportedly asked to step down as they were appointed by the previous UPA government.

The names of the governors are likely to be declared on Sunday. 

Uttar Pradesh Governor BL Joshi, Chhattisgarh Governor Shekhar Dutt and Nagaland Governor Ashwani Kumar had earlier stepped down from their respective posts. 

MK Narayanan (West Bengal) and BV Wanchoo (Goa) put in their papers later, after being questioned in connection with a chopper scam. 

Meanwhile, Karnataka Governor HR Bhardwaj and Tripura Governor Devanand Konwar retired. 

Bhardwaj was the Law Minister in UPA-I government while Konwar was a former Congress minister in Assam. 

Both were appointed as Governors of their respective states in 2009.
